Overview of the 2010 DODGE CALIBER
The 2010 DODGE CALIBER has received a total of 246 safety complaints fil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). There have been 4 recall campaigns affecting this vehicle, covering issues with SEAT BELTS:PRETENSIONER, AIR BAGS:FRONTAL:SENSOR/CONTROL MODULE-INACTIVE, AIR BAGS. 2 technical service bulletins have been issued by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) for this model year. The most commonly reported problems involve the Air Bags (30 complaints), Electrical System (30 complaints), and Suspension (25 complaints).
Recalls for the 2010 DODGE CALIBER
NHTSA has recorded 4 recalls for the 2010 DODGE CALIBER, potentially affecting up to 4,306,998 vehicles.
Recall 16V668000 — SEAT BELTS:PRETENSIONER
| 1,435,625 vehicles affected
Defect: Chrysler (FCA US LLC) is recalling certain model year 2011-2014 Chrysler 200, 2010 Chrysler Sebring, 2010-2012 Dodge Caliber and 2010-2014 Jeep Patriot, Compass and Dodge Avenger vehicles. The Occupant Restraint Control (OCR) module may short circuit, preventing the frontal air bags, seat belt pretensioners, and side air bags from deploying in the event of a crash.
Consequence: If the frontal air bags, seat belt pretensioners, and side air bags are disabled, there is an increased risk of injury to the vehicle occupants in the event of a vehicle crash that necessitates deployment of these safety systems.
Remedy: Chrysler will notify owners, and dealers will replace the OCR, free of charge. Interim letters informing owners that parts are not available yet were mailed on October 26, 2016. The recall began on August 15, 2017. Owners may contact Chrysler...

View full details →Recall 10V197000 — LATCHES/LOCKS/LINKAGES:DOORS:LATCH
| 123 vehicles affected
Defect: CHRYSLER I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2010 DODGE CALIBER VEHICLES. SOME VEHICLES MAY HAVE BEEN BUILT WITH AN INCORRECT DOOR LOCK ROD IN THE RIGHT FRONT DOOR.
Consequence: AN UNLATCHED DOOR COULD INCREASE THE RISK OF AN UNBELTED FRONT SEAT PASSENGER BEING EJECTED FROM THE VEHICLE.
Remedy: DEALERS WILL INSPECT AND REPLACE THE FRONT RIGHT DOOR LOCK ROD AS REQUIRED F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L IS EXPECTED TO BEGIN DURING JUNE 2010. OWNERS MAY CONTACT CHRYSLER AT 1-800-853-1403.

I was just at the dealer mechanic for an oil change and asked about a slight pull to one side when stopping. after doing the oil change he cam back with a list of things the most significant of which was a that the front sub-frame was rotted out, as well as the rear bumper metal under the plastic cover. They gave me an estimate for the repairs exceeding $7000. Then I came home an researched this problem and find its common on these calibers from 2007-2012 and is a known problem!? but no recall was ever issued! There was a "Customer Satisfaction Notification X69" Which I never received. I have also had the vehicle into the dealer other times recently and was never informed of this issue which couldn't have possibly happened over night.

The contact owns a 2010 Dodge Caliber. The contact stated that while his wife was driving at an undisclosed speed, the engine unexpectedly shut off. The vehicle was able to be restarted. The engine oil warning light as intermittently illuminated. The vehicle was taken to an independent mechanic, but no cause of failure was found. The vehicle was not repaired. The contact stated that the failure recurred. The contact related the failure to NHTSA Campaign Number: 14V373000 (Electrical System, Air Bags); however, the VIN was not included in the recall. The manufacturer was not made aware of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 103,000.

Technical Service Bulletins for the 2010 DODGE CALIBER
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) has issued 2 technical service bulletins (TSBs) for the 2010 DODGE CALIBER. TSBs are notices sent by manufacturers to their dealers describing a known issue and the recommended repair procedure.
23-033-20 — SEATS
Active Head Restraint (AHR) Inadvertent Deployment - X91 Warranty Extension This bulletin involves inspecting the sled bracket striker pin and possibly replacing a front seat AHR that has inadvertently deployed. Customers may comment on the following: The AHR is deployed on one or both front seats and will not reset.
23-007-17 REV. B — WHEELS
Front And Rear Crossmember Corrosion (X69 Warranty Extension) This bulletin involves inspecting the front and rear crossmembers for perforation/rust through and if necessary, replacing the crossmember(s). Customers may describe a vibration at the steering wheel or may have been informed by a technician or state vehicle inspection that the front...
